VISIT Mandurah is supporting and promoting local impact project, Estuary Guardians over summer. All visitors who opt in for a VISIT Mandurah: Summer '23 Impact Certificate unlock local rewards and contribute towards Estuary Guardians who Respect, Protect and Connect Mandurah's Dolphin population.

This Impact Certificate represents the tangible outcome of funding half a FinBook. FinBooks are created to help the community identify Mandurah’s dolphins and understand their behaviours. FinBooks also educate on how we can all do our part to protect them – inspiring more people to become guardians of the ‘Peel-Harvey Estuary’.

Estuary Guardians Mandurah

Estuary Guardians was established in 2015 by John Tonkin College students & teachers - working with rescue, research, business and schools, to encourage people to look after Mandurah’s dolphins and environment. It has since evolved into a community driven group - incorporating Mandurah Volunteer Dolphin Rescue Group.
